<p style="text-align: justify;"><strong>Bangkok earthquake:</strong> More than 1600 deaths have been confirmed so far in the disastrous earthquake on Friday (March 28) in Myanmar. There is a possibility of killing 10 thousand people here. At the same time, this earthquake also led to 18 deaths in Bangkok, the capital of Thailand. Out of these 18, 11 deaths occurred due to falling only one building, whose video is viral on social media for the last two days. Now a big controversy is arising in Bangkok regarding this building.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Actually, Bangkok is full of skyscrapers, but only a tall building collapsed during the earthquake. Interestingly, this building was building a Chinese company. It is also surprising that the Chinese company was also having big boars for this building. It was being said that this building would be the strongest building in Bankock. But see the havoc of nature that he only chose it in hundreds of buildings.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><strong>5 billion building, destroyed in 5 seconds</strong><br />This building was being built for the State Audit Office of Thailand. It was being made together with Italian-Tahi Development PLC and China&#8217;s railway number-10 engineering group together. There was a deal to build this building for 5 billion rupees. Its work was going on for the last three years. The building was almost complete and only outside work was left but before the inauguration, the building became grounded.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">The 30 -storey building fell into the early tremors of the earthquake. When this accident happened, dozens of people were working here. Till now, not all people have been removed from its debris. On the other hand, now the tone of protest is also being heard in Bangkok regarding this building. This is the reason that the Thailand government has put an investigation on the fall of this building.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><strong>Investigation report sought within 7 days</strong><br />Thailand&#8217;s Home Minister Anutin Charanviku has sought the findings of the investigation within seven days. He said on Sunday that a committee has been formed to investigate and it is expected that the investigation will be completed in seven days. He said, &#8216;Thailand will soon find out why the building collapsed. It was just made and should have been designed to withstand the earthquake.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">The Home Minister said, &#8216;The earthquake was of intensity of 7.7 but more than 95% of the buildings were faced. Only the state audit building collapsed. This building was new. Therefore, it should have faced earthquake. He said that the investigation will focus on architects, construction supervisors and builders. In this case, Thai and Chinese partners will have to share responsibility.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><strong>Chinese employees stole documents</strong><br />During this time, four Chinese employees were also questioned for efforts to disappear the documents related to the construction of this building. 32 files were found from containers behind the collapsed building. The police have seized these documents. On the other hand, China is also in action and has sent an expert to inspect the collapse and find out the reason for its fall.</p>

<p style="text-align: justify;"><strong>Myanmar earthquake:</strong> The horrific earthquake in Myanmar on Friday (March 28, 2025) has caused huge devastation. So far, the number of dead has reached 1700, while 17 people have lost their lives in neighboring country Thailand. Earthquakes have collapsed buildings, bridges have fallen and roads have been damaged.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Amidst this devastation, the shadow of Myanmar has announced a unilateral partial ceasefire to expedite relief work. According to news agency AP, the number of injured has increased to 3,408, while 139 people are missing. Officials are warning that the number of dead may increase further with search and rescue operations.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><strong>5 important updates related to earthquake</strong></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><strong>1. Mandalay city affected the most</strong><br />The earthquake had a profound impact on a population of 1.7 million in Mandle city. The 6.7 intensity shocks here spread panic among the people. Local people themselves are also engaged in relief work to save the people trapped in the debris.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><strong>2. Local people are looking for dead body by removing debris</strong><br />Local tea shop owner Vin Lvin said that 7 people died in the rubble of his restaurant. According to the news agency AFP, he is trying to remove the dead body by removing the bricks but he does not expect that someone will be alive.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><strong>3. India sent relief and rescue assistance</strong><br />India has sent necessary supply, medical equipment and rescue teams to Myanmar. 5 military aircraft have arrived with relief materials, including the 80 -member National Disaster Response Force (NDRF) team and a military regional hospital. Apart from this, 40 tons of human assistance is being sent from INS Satpura and INS Savitri.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><strong>4. United Nations and Relief Agencies concern</strong><br />The United Nations has warned that Myanmar does not have enough medical facilities. 3.5 million people are displaced in this country already facing civil war and the danger of starvation has increased. Relief agencies said that Myanmar was not ready for this level disaster.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><strong>5. Destruction in Thailand, 17 killed</strong><br />The earthquake demolished a 30 -storey building under construction in Bangkok, killing at least 17 people and 32 injured. 83 people are still missing, who are expected to be buried under the rubble. The rescue team is trying to save people with the help of drones, investigative dogs and excavation machines.</p>

<p><strong>Earthquake in china:</strong> Myanmar caused a 7.7 magnitude earthquake on Friday (March 28), killing at least 1,644 people and injured more than 3,400 people. Earthquake tremors were also felt in many neighboring countries like Thailand, China, Vietnam and Bangladesh. </p>
<p>Meanwhile, CCTV footage at a hospital in Yunnan, China showed that two nurses of the maternity ward were risking their lives and protecting newborns, while the entire hospital was shaking due to the earthquake.</p>
<p><strong>Nurses saved newborns during earthquake</strong></p>
<p>In this video, which is going viral on social media, it can be seen that during the earthquake, children were filled with cradle in the ward. Due to sharp tremors, the wheel bed started rolling around the whole room. A nurse, who was sitting on the floor and carrying a child on her lap, grabbed a cradle moving with a shock so that it would not fall. At the same time, the second nurse standing nearby took immediate steps to handle the two ups of two, so that there is no harm to the children.</p>

<p style="text-align: justify;"><strong>Earthquake in Bangkok:</strong> The tremors of a strong earthquake in Myanmar caused huge havoc in Bangkok, the capital of Thailand. So far 10 people have died in this disaster, 16 people have been injured and 101 people are missing. According to Thailand&#8217;s Disaster Prevention and Mitigation Department (DDPM), Bangkok and two other provinces have been declared an emergency disaster area. Officers are assessing losses in the affected areas. DDPM Director General Fasacorn Bunyalak said that the earthquake has caused damage in 14 provinces.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">On Friday, people who escaped from the fierce earthquake in Myanmar and Thailand shared their story. He told about the horror incidents and difficult situations that he faced.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><strong>&#8216;Was like a nightmare for me&#8217;</strong></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">According to The Hindu report, 55 -year -old accounts and tax consultant SK Jain, who lived in Bangkok, went to the Jewelery Trade Center (JTC) in the Silom area for a meeting on Friday. At 1:16 pm, when they reached the 40th floor of the 59-mangila building, they messaged a colleague that they would return later. But after two minutes, the entire building started shaking. Mr. Jain recalled that he was trapped in the tall building during the earthquake.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">He told, &#8216;This was a terrible experience, the most scary moment of my life. I was very nervous. The first shock was felt at 1:18 pm. The curtains in the room where I was, started moving more than one foot. It looked very scary. We all quickly ran towards the stairs. Some people told that they had left their eight and 10 carat diamonds on a table while running outside.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">He further said, &#8216;When we reached the 21st floor, the second shock was felt. At that time we were between the 18th and 21st floors. The stairs started moving loudly. I was missing every god at that time. I felt that I would not be able to escape, but somehow I reached 40 floor below in 7.5 minutes. More than 1,500 people also came down with me. In a hurry, many people also left their phones in the office.</p>

<p style="text-align: justify;"><strong>Myanmar earthquake:</strong> The death toll from the horrific earthquake in Myanmar and Thailand has crossed 1600. Meanwhile, rescuers are doing rescue operations to take out the people trapped in the debris. On the afternoon of Friday (March 28, 2025), a 7.7 magnitude earthquake occurred in the north-west of the city of Sagiing in Central Myanmar, which a few minutes later a second blow of 6.7 magnitude, which caused heavy havoc.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">These tremors ruined buildings and important infrastructure including roads and bridges in Myanmar. Mandalay, the country&#8217;s second largest city, was also destroyed. Myanmar&#8217;s military administration, Junta, said in a statement that 1,644 people were killed and more than 3,400 people were injured in the country. At least 139 people are missing. On the other hand, about 10 more people have been confirmed in Bangkok.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><strong>Announcement of Emergency in Myanmar</strong></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">The Junta chief Min Aung Holiing has appealed to the international community to help the threatened country. This appeal reflects the effect of earthquake. Myanmar has declared emergency in the most affected areas. The United States, India, China and many other countries have promised to help Myanmar.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><strong>Myanmar earthquake also impact in Thailand</strong></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">The intensity of the earthquake can be gauged from the fact that the tremors were so powerful that the buildings located in Bangkok, hundreds of kilometers from the center, suffered serious damage. The centuries -old Buddhist pagoda in Mandley has turned into debris. According to the report, teams and equipment have been ordered from other countries, but they are being interrupted due to the damaged airports of those cities.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Employees in Nipita are trying to repair damaged roads, while electricity, phones and internet services are still interrupted in most parts of the city. In Bangkok, rescuers are making tireless efforts to evacuate people trapped in the debris of a 30 -storey skyscraper. Bangkok Governor Chadachar Cittypunt said that eight people have been confirmed so far in the building collapse, while at least eight others have been rescued. 79 people are still missing in the building.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><strong>India sent help </strong></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Amid the death and devastation caused by the horrific earthquake in Myanma, India on Saturday delivered 15 tonnes of relief material and sent more supply to the air and sea route with rescue teams under the Emergency Mission &#8216;Operation Brahma&#8217;. Prime Minister Narendra Modi spoke to Myanma&#8217;s military general Min Aung Having and said that India stands with him in solidarity in efforts to deal with the devastation caused by the fierce earthquake in the country.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">India has named its rescue operation for Myanma as &#8216;Operation Brahma&#8217;. A few hours after India transported 15 tonnes of necessary relief material to Yangon from a military transport aircraft, another military aircraft landed with a group of rescue personnel and landed in Myanmar&#8217;s capital Nependita.</p>

<p style="text-align: justify;"><strong>15 earthquakes within 10 hours</strong><br />According to the US Geological Survey, a total of 15 earthquakes occurred in Myanmar within 10 hours on Friday. The first earthquake was of 7.7 intensity, which is given above the description of the catastrophe. Even after this, earthquakes of low and high intensity continued to occur. An earthquake also occurred of 6.4 magnitude. In such a situation, the people of Myanmar are currently living in the shadow of fear. However, this is not the first time when there were so many earthquakes in Myanmar. There is a long history of earthquake here.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><strong>Why do I come to Myanmar so much earthquake?</strong><br />Myanmar is located on the border between two tectonic plates. This is called the saging area. Myanmar is one of the most seismically active countries in the world. However, large and disastrous earthquakes are rarely seen in the saging area.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Professor and earthquake expert Joanna Fore Walker at University College London told in a conversation with Reuters, &#8216;India plate and eurasia plates run in different directions. One north and the other south. It passes through the middle of Myanmar. The plates pass through each other horizontally at different speeds. This causes &#8220;strike slip&#8221; earthquakes which are usually less powerful than earthquakes in areas like Sumatra, where one plate slips under the other.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;"><strong>Why was Friday&#8217;s earthquake so devastating? </strong><br />British geologist Roger Musus told Reuters that the low depth of the earthquake means that the loss would be more serious. The center of earthquake in Myanmar was at a depth of just 10 km. That is why the loss was more. He said, &#8216;Shockwaves are not destroyed when the earthquake is a center from the center of the earthquake to the surface. In such a situation, the buildings have to face the strength of shaking. This is what happened in Myanmar.</p>

<p style="text-align: justify;"><strong>Myanmar earthquake:</strong> According to the US Geological Survey (USGS), a total of 14 earthquakes were recorded in Myanmar within 10 hours on Friday (March 28). The intensity of the first earthquake was 7.7. This was followed by a second powerful shock of 6.7 magnitude.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Till Saturday, Myanmar&#8217;s ruling Junta confirmed that the death toll from the earthquake has increased to 694, while 1,670 people were injured. Rescue operations are still going on. It is believed that this figure may increase further. The epicenter of the earthquake was in the north-west of the city of Sagiing, which became the main victim of this disaster. The region is known for seismic activities, and this earthquake has widely damaged buildings and infrastructure in the central part of Myanmar.</p>
